Etymology

[edit]

From Dutch Zefanja, from Hebrew צְפַנְיָה (ts'fanyá).

Pronunciation

[edit]
  • IPA(key): /zəˈfa.ɲa/, [zəˈfa.ɲa]
  • Hyphenation: Ze‧fa‧nya

Proper noun

[edit]

Zefanya

  1. Zephaniah
    1. (Christianity, Judaism) Hebrew prophet associated with the Book of Zephaniah
    2. (Christianity, Judaism) a book of the Old Testament and the Hebrew Tanakh.
